A circular disc of radius R is removed from a bigger circular disc of radius 2R, such that the circumference of the disc coincides. The centre of mass of the new disc is αR from the centre of bigger disc. The value of alpha is |
|
Answer» `1/3` Mass of disc removed, `m_(1) = m/4` Mass of remaining disc `=(3m)/4` Mass `m_(1)` and `m_(2)` are concentrated at `O_(1)` and `O_(2)` respectively and O is their centre of mass. Moment of `m_(1)` about O = moment of `m_(2)` about O. `m/4 xx R = (3m)/R xx ALPHA R RARR alpha =1/3` |
